Press & Content Creators' Videos of Microsoft Flight Simulator Released

The NDA embargo for selected press and content creators was lifted at 0700 GMT today, with new videos published covering various aspects of the simulator.

Starting with large press outlets, PC Gamer has published two videos looking at famous places around the world, along with another video that puts the eye in storm with stormy weather.

IGN released more extensive videos. They began with a ‘Final Preview’, before proceeding to show six landing challenges and a full flight from San Francisco to Las Vegas in the default A320neo.

Other known names including Eurogamer (in Italian) and Tom’s Hardware (in Italian) join more close to home outlets such as FSElite in releasing new videos, with the latter having released a new video of Microsoft Flight Simulator in 4K.

Content creators were also able to get their hands on the simulator, including flightdeck2sim, Chewwy, and The Flight Sim Deck.
